Today, I’m thrilled to be joined by Heather Plett. Heather is known internationally as an expert in the art of holding space. What does it mean to become an expert in “holding space?” Well, as Heather reflects, “ In my case, it took a lot of grief and trauma and many years of fumbling…” and she says, “I think it’s true that many of us end up teaching what we most need to learn.”

I first met Heather through her online workshop, The Art of Holding Space, named after her book. Through her book and her workshops, Heather takes us through how to “hold and support ourselves” as we form a deep connection to ourselves and open ourselves to others on our journey of healing and growth. Heather is an international speaker, facilitator, and writer whose workshops and seminars span six continents. Her writing has appeared in Harvard Business Review among other publications, and she has been quoted in multiple books, and contributed to training curriculum for nurses, hospice care workers, yoga teachers, facilitators, and military chaplains. She lives in Winnipeg, Canada, with her three daughters, and she is just a beautiful soul.
